Ankündigung

Einklappen
Keine Ankündigung bisher.

ESP8266 KNX mit ETS

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• christianCR
    antwortet
    Eine weitere Frage welche mir noch eingefallen ist, kann man den Stack auch OTA auf einen ESP bringen? Es gibt da durchaus einige Ansätze, die es ermöglichen dem ESP Änderungen in der Software / Firmware über die Wlan Schnittstelle bereit zu stellen, dies fände ich noch recht interessand, da dies dann nicht bedeutet das man den ESP ständig ausbauen muss.

    Gruß,
    Christian

    Einen Kommentar schreiben:


  • mumpf
    antwortet
    Hi,

    Zitat von christianCR Beitrag anzeigen
    da ich auch direkt damit dann die zweite fliege erschlagrn kann, da ich den 1wire bus ablösen möchte und sich da der stack und das Sensormodul von Matthias anbietet.
    für das Sensormodul von Matthias habe ich mit diesem Stack eine Firmware geschrieben, das müsstest Du nicht mehr selber machen . Aber wie gesagt, für die LED-Stripes solltest Du nicht mit 240 KO arbeiten und die Effekte direkt auf dem Modul implementieren und nur per KNX abrufen.

    Gruß, Waldemar

    Einen Kommentar schreiben:


  • christianCR
    antwortet
    henfri war die frage an mich gerichtet?

    Wenn ja, leider keinen link, ist eine selbst konstruierte lampe aus Granit mit selbst geschriebener software.

    Einen Kommentar schreiben:


  • christianCR
    antwortet
    Hallo Waldemar,

    Ich möchte / muss vo. Bluetooth mesh weg. Dieses ist leider nicht sonderlich stabil bzw recht intensiv in der wartung.

    Daher der wechsel zu ESP mit wlan. Und da ich bei meiner suche hier im Forum dann über den Stack gestolpert bin wäre das eine reght praktische lösung, da ich auch direkt damit dann die zweite fliege erschlagrn kann, da ich den 1wire bus ablösen möchte und sich da der stack und das Sensormodul von Matthias anbietet.

    Einen Kommentar schreiben:


  • henfri
    antwortet
    Ich bin neugierig. Was für ein Gerät ist das? Hast du einen Link?

    Einen Kommentar schreiben:


  • mumpf
    antwortet

    Hi Christian,

    DPT 232.600 funktioniert in dem Stack, nutze ich auch. 240 KO gehen auch, ich nutze selber über 300 KO in meiner Sensormodul-Firmware. Technisch also kein Problem.

    ABER: Selbst wenn Du mit maximaler Busgeschwindigkeit alle LEDs einmal setzen willst, brauchst Du mit ca. 30 KO/s ganze 8 Sekunden, um alle LEDs zu setzen. Das ist für Effekte überhaupt nicht geeignet - der KNX-Bus ist dafür auch nicht gedacht.

    Zitat von christianCR Beitrag anzeigen
    Derzeit steuert das ein raspi über ein Bluetooth mesh dem kann ich über eine website sagen welche farbe oder welche sequenz ich haben möchte und dieser schickt dann die entsprechenden arrays zu jeder lampe.
    Warum machst Du das nicht genau so? Du programmierst die gewünschten Sequenzen auf dem Modul. Und per KNX wählst Du einfach eine Szene aus, die die entsprechende Sequenz adressiert. Alles andere wird nicht erwartungskonform funktionieren.

    Gruß, Waldemar


    Einen Kommentar schreiben:


  • christianCR
    antwortet
    Wollte jetzt nicht den Thread kapern.

    Derzeit steuert das ein raspi über ein Bluetooth mesh dem kann ich über eine website sagen welche farbe oder welche sequenz ich haben möchte und dieser schickt dann die entsprechenden arrays zu jeder lampe. Es sind insgesamt 7 lampen.

    Ich fürchte nur das ich damit dann auch die buslast ganz schön nach oben treibe. Oder ich muss nur noch auf farbeinstellung setzten.

    Gruß christian

    Einen Kommentar schreiben:


  • henfri
    antwortet
    Zitat von christianCR Beitrag anzeigen
    hab gerade nochmal nachgezählt jede lampe hat 40 leds die individuell angesteuert werden könnten.
    Ui.
    und wie steuerst du die heute an?


    Dann bräuchte ich 120 kommunikationsobjekte je lampe.
    Nehmen wir Mal an dein ESP Gerät kann dann einen Array... Wer soll die Daten senden?

    Gruß,
    Hendrik

    Einen Kommentar schreiben:


  • christianCR
    antwortet
    Ja richtig das wäre auch eine alternative.

    aber auch dabei würden dann alle pixel (led) die selbe Farbe haben.
    hab gerade nochmal nachgezählt jede lampe hat 40 leds die individuell angesteuert werden könnten. Ich denke sowas wie arrays kennt KNX nicht richtig?

    Dann bräuchte ich 120 kommunikationsobjekte je lampe.

    Einen Kommentar schreiben:


  • henfri
    antwortet
    Du kannst doch auch je Farbe einen Prozentwert übertragen.
    Also drei kommunikationsobjekte.

    Einen Kommentar schreiben:


  • christianCR
    antwortet
    Hallo zusammen, ich habe mir vor einiger Zeit für meinen Vorgarten Wegleuchten mit RGBW Led Streifen gebaut, welche zur Ansteuerung einen ESP8266 verwenden. Ursprünglich war der Plan über MQTT telegramme an die Beleuchtung zu senden, so das diese dann jeweils die Leds entsprechend schalten. Nun habe ich aber dieses Projekt gesehen und finde es insgesamt aber besser die Leuchten direkt mit KNX ansprechen zu können.

    Da ich leider damals keine grüne Leitung zu den Lampen gezogen habe müsste alles entsprechend über die WLan Verbindung gehen, was soweit ich es Verstanden habe auch schon mit dem Stack funktionieren würde? Oder habe ich hier etwas missverstanden?

    Was mir noch nicht ganz klar ist, wie ich die Daten am Besten über mittele. MDT nutzt beispielsweise den Datentyp DPT 232.600 mit 3 Byte Damit könnte man die Farbe übermitteln, da es sich um digitale Streifen handelt, müsste die Farbe ggf. ja für jede Led im Streifen gesetzt werden, also eine Art Array. Gibt es dazu ggf. auch schon etwas oder hat da jemand schonmal was probiert?

    Gruß,
    Christian

    Einen Kommentar schreiben:


  • Weltenbummler
    antwortet
    Ich glaube, ich habe meinen Fehler gefunden. Die Namen für die ParameterTypes hatte ich alle mit "t_" begonnen. Den Underscore im Namen mag die ETS wohl nicht, das hatte ich auch irgendwo im Thread gelesen aber wieder verdrängt.
    Auf jeden Fall kann ich die so erzeugte knxprod jetzt importieren.
    Allerdings habe ich jetzt noch ein Problem mit der EEPROM library. Die Parametrierung mit der ETS läuft durch, ich sehe auch den HEX-String bei SAVED mit augenscheinlich korrekten Daten. Nach dem Reboot kommen bei RESTORED lauter FFs. Testweise habe ich bei EEPROM.commit eine Debugausgabe eingebaut und sehe, dass commit mit 0 zurück kommt. Bei der Demo hatte ich sowas am Anfang auch. Irgendwann gings dann aber. Hmm.

    Einen Kommentar schreiben:


  • Alloc
    antwortet
    Hatte manchmal das Gefühl, dass mehrmaliges Löschen aus dem Katalog (und vorher dem Projekt) und danach importieren irgendwann hilft ... Hatte den Fehler jedenfalls auch einige Male und irgendwie ging es dann immer
    Die ETS ist da wohl sehr pingelig an irgendeiner bescheuerten Stelle.

    Einen Kommentar schreiben:


  • thesing
    antwortet
    Man sollte zusehen, dass man immer zumindest die Version erhöht bei einem Import der knxprod. Wenn man das mal vergessen hat, kann man die importieren Geräte auch im Dateisystem löschen. Ich glaube der Pfad ist in den tiefen des Threads vergraben.

    Einen Kommentar schreiben:


  • madon
    antwortet
    Hast du schon mal versucht die alte Beschreibung aus dem Katalog zu löschen?

    Einen Kommentar schreiben:

Lädt...
X